在海洋行业中,水文数据的处理是非常重要的一项工作。而雷达图像的绘制又是水文数据处理中不可或缺的一环。在这篇文章中,我将向大家介绍MATLAB在海洋水文数据处理中的雷达图像绘制应用。
7 b' P6 M6 w* g
8 A" k4 a) T; l$ e: q7 }首先,让我们来了解一下MATLAB是什么。MATLAB是一种高级技术计算语言和环境,常被用于科学和工程领域的数据分析、可视化和模拟。它以其强大的功能和灵活性而闻名,因此成为了海洋领域中数据处理的首选工具之一。
7 [+ Z. {/ ?7 R* A& g, c. L1 L5 D
0 K0 B5 Y) _5 l, x- c7 M在海洋水文数据处理中,雷达图像的绘制被广泛应用。雷达图像可以显示出水体中的物理特征,如海流、海浪、海底地形等。通过对这些图像的分析,研究人员可以了解海洋的动态变化及其对环境的影响。因此,准确地绘制出雷达图像对海洋研究至关重要。
" k- r: R A8 c0 \( x5 n7 G; w1 V/ ~; T5 }
MATLAB提供了丰富的绘图函数和工具箱,使得绘制雷达图像变得简单而高效。首先,在进行雷达图像绘制前,我们需要载入所需的数据。这些数据通常是通过海洋观测设备,如卫星、浮标和潜水器等收集得到的。在MATLAB中,我们可以使用数据导入工具箱来读取这些数据,并将其转换为合适的格式。
- i( ^' G0 q" c7 E( T, S: }/ Q
接下来,我们需要选择合适的绘图函数来绘制雷达图像。MATLAB提供了诸多绘图函数,如plot、scatter、contour等。根据具体的需求,我们可以选择不同的函数来展示不同的信息。例如,如果我们想要显示海洋表面的海浪高度,可以使用contour函数来创建等高线图。而如果我们想要显示海洋底部的地形特征,可以使用scatter函数来绘制散点图。$ c2 K0 K! \: m4 r- \8 I% f3 E
6 _; p3 _% t+ H' h6 h2 O7 \( q在绘制雷达图像时,我们还可以进行一些数据处理和分析。MATLAB提供了丰富的数学和统计函数,可以对数据进行加工和处理。例如,我们可以使用滤波函数来去除无关的噪声,或者使用插值函数来填补缺失的数据。这些功能使得数据处理变得灵活而便捷。
; l8 r6 t% b; D/ U3 `
9 M4 p: Q. I. b: T8 ~! B H除了基本的雷达图像绘制,MATLAB还提供了许多高级的绘图功能。例如,通过使用绘图工具箱中的交互式绘图功能,我们可以实时调整图像的参数,以获取更好的显示效果。此外,还可以使用图层功能来叠加不同的数据,从而实现更复杂的图像分析。8 ]7 Z/ ]2 |; K( R0 I# G2 ~ y
$ O4 S! X7 z4 `) @& u
总之,MATLAB在海洋水文数据处理中的雷达图像绘制应用是非常广泛和重要的。它提供了丰富的功能和工具,使得数据处理和分析变得简单而高效。通过合理地利用MATLAB的各种函数和工具,我们可以快速准确地绘制出海洋中的雷达图像,并深入地研究海洋的动态变化。希望本文能对您有所启发,谢谢阅读! |